VBA还要学吗 怎么入门Excel VBA
对于是否还需要学习VBA(Visual Basic for Applications),答案是肯定的。VBA是自动化Excel工作流程、提高工作效率、进行复杂数据处理以及构建用户界面的重要工具,对于财务分析师、数据分析师、市场分析师以及任何需要处理大量Excel数据的人来说,学习VBA非常有必要。VBA的学习可以从理解其在自动化任务中的作用入手,如用于报表生成、数据分析及格式化等,通过自动化简化重复性和耗时任务,极大地提高工作效率。
首先,我们需要认识到VBA的重要性。VBA使得在Excel中的重复操作和计算被自动化处理,极大减少手动错误及工作量,尤其在处理大型数据和复杂报告时尤为重要。例如,在金融领域中,自动化财务报告的生成,不仅可以节省时间,也可以减少人为计算错误的可能,确保数据的一致性和准确性。
学习VBA之前,先对Excel本身有一定的了解和使用经验是非常必要的。然后,可以从VBA的基础语法、控制结构(如循环、条件判断等)开始入手。理解对象模型(如工作簿Workbook、工作表Worksheet等)是学习VBA不可忽视的一环,因为它涉及到如何在VBA中操作Excel的各种元素。
实践是学习VBA的关键。初学者可以从录制宏开始,宏录制是一个非常直观的方式来熟悉VBA环境和基本语法。通过宏录制完成一些简单的自动化任务后,可以尝试修改宏代码,以此来进一步学习VBA的语言结构及其应用方法。
在具备一定的VBA基础后,通过实际项目来深化理解是非常有效的学习方法。可以选择一些实际问题,如数据分析、报告自动化等,尝试使用VBA来解决。这些实战项目不仅能加深对VBA的理解,还可以发现和解决实际工作中遇到的问题。
掌握了VBA的基础之后,可以进一步学习如何使用VBA处理更复杂的数据分析任务、怎样创建用户自定义的功能和表单等进阶内容。了解如何通过VBA与其他应用程序进行交互(如通过ADO连接数据库)也是提升技能的重要环节。
优质的学习资源是学习VBA的重要助力。包括在线教程、书籍、视频课程和博客等。挑选适合自己当前水平的资源,按部就班地学习。
加入一些Excel和VBA相关的社区或论坛,可以让你在学习过程中不断获得动力和灵感。在社区中,你可以提问、分享自己的学习经验、解决他人遇到的问题,甚至参与开源项目。
学习VBA是一个持续深化的过程,需要通过不断的学习和实践来积累经验。记住,熟能生巧,通过不断地实践和尝试,你会逐渐发现VBA为你的工作带来的便利和效率的提升。开始可能会有些挑战,但只要坚持下去,你会发现学习VBA是值得的。
【FAQ 1】:VBA在Excel中有什么应用场景?
VBA在Excel中可以应用于自动化常规的重复性工作,如数据分析、报表生成、数据导入导出等。它可以帮助你编写宏代码来自动完成各种任务,提高工作效率。同时,VBA也可以用于创建自定义的用户界面,增强Excel的功能和交互性。
【FAQ 2】:VBA的学习难度如何?有哪些入门学习资源?
学习VBA的难度因人而异,对于有编程基础的人来说相对容易上手。对于没有编程经验的人来说,可能需要花费一些时间来学习基本的编程概念和语法。入门学习资源有很多,如在线教程、视频教程、书籍等。你可以选择适合自己的学习方式来入门VBA。
【FAQ 3】:学会VBA对职业发展有什么帮助?
学会VBA可以使你在Excel相关的工作中更加高效和自动化,提升工作效率,节省时间和精力。这对于从事数据分析、财务统计、商务报告等职位的人来说尤为重要。同时,熟练掌握VBA还可以在求职中起到加分的作用,增加自己的竞争力。
版权声明:本文内容由网络用户投稿,版权归原作者所有,本站不拥有其著作权,亦不承担相应法律责任。如果您发现本站中有涉嫌抄袭或描述失实的内容,请联系邮箱:hopper@cornerstone365.cn 处理,核实后本网站将在24小时内删除。
相关文章推荐
立即开启你的数字化管理
用心为每一位用户提供专业的数字化解决方案及业务咨询